Drain Clog Prevention
Of course, the most efficient method of removing clogs is avoiding them in the first place. You can take a few precautions to ensure your plumbing services remain functional at all times and you aren’t left dealing with clogged drains.
One of the most effective ways to protect your drains is installing screens over top of them. These wire or mesh constructions fit over the opening in your drains, stopping large food particles and hair from becoming an issue. These devices won’t stop water from emptying from your fixtures, as long as you remember to clean them out a few times per week.
Another way to prevent drain clogs is being aware of everything you’re putting into your sinks. Naturally, it’s tempting to dump grease and oil down your drains because it’s an easy clean-up method. However, these substances will quickly harden as they reach room temperature and could clog your drains. It’s best to avoid putting grease and oil into your drains altogether to prevent this issue.

The process often begins with a sewer camera inspection, where we’ll push a small camera into your drain and take a video. We can view the obstruction through this video, allowing us to develop a custom solution to your problem.
The resolution that we come up with could involve hydro jetting, a process where we send a pressurized stream of water into your drain to disrupt any debris that’s stuck there. Hydro jetting is quick, easy, and entirely safe for your pipes, which is why it’s a favored drain cleaning method in Tukwila, WA.
Another solution we might consider is using a specialized tool to cut through the obstruction in your drain, chopping it into smaller, more manageable pieces. It’s easier to move these small pieces through your pipes to the city main because they’re less likely to get stuck.
We’ll then complete another camera inspection in your drain and pipes to ensure we’ve removed the complete obstruction. In doing so, you can be confident that the repair will last, and you won’t find yourself in a similar situation in a few months.
